  • Patent number: 11084659
    Abstract: A transport device includes an entry finger that guides a conveyor as it carries items thereon in a transport direction from the rear deflector to the front deflector. The conveyor slides along a sliding strip that is supported by a profile element that is supported by a support. The entry finger guides the conveyor around the front deflector, where the conveyor reverses direction. The entry finger couples to the transport device by a detachable connection. The detachable connection is either a locking connection that connects the entry finger to the sliding strip, an insertion connection that connects the entry finger to the profiled element, or a detachable connection formed by a quick fastener between the support and the profiled element and the finger.

  • Patent number: 9862547
    Abstract: A multi-track conveyor for transporting containers includes two transport elements adjacent to one another to form a common transport surface on which the containers stand upright on their container bases. Each transport element has a dedicated electric drive motor. The drive motors are external-rotor motors with an internal stator connected in a torsion-resistant manner to a machine frame and with an external rotor, which forms an offset drive driving the respective transport element. The drive motors of at least two transport elements are coaxial with their motor axles oriented perpendicular to the transport direction. The stators of which are connected via a common support in a rotation-resistant manner to the machine frame.

  • Patent number: 8919536
    Abstract: A conveying device for conveying containers in a conveying direction, the containers having bottoms, each of which has a cross-section characterized by a standing-bottom diameter or a smaller and larger standing-bottom diameter. The device has conveyor belts extending along a conveying direction forming a closed loop. The conveyor belts form, with upper-loop lengths thereof, a sub-region of a conveying surface, the upper-loop lengths being disposed adjacent to each other in a rows offset in an axial direction. The containers stand on the upper-loop lengths on their bottoms. The conveyor belts have a width that, for containers having a circular cross-section, is smaller than half the standing-bottom diameter of the smallest container diameter to be conveyed, and, for containers having a non-circular cross-section, is smaller than half a smaller standing-bottom diameter of a smallest container diameter to be conveyed.
